Ruby Meadowhawk, (male).

Sympetrum rubicundulum

Description:

Eyes red over grayish-green; face tan, slightly more reddish above. Thorax red. Abdomen bright red with elongate black ventrolateral triangles on S4-9.

Habitat:

Field edge close to alder swamp.
